Introduction

Minimalist design in contemporary architecture highlights simplicity, functionality, and the aesthetic value of minimalism. This architectural approach removes unnecessary elements, focusing on essential features that result in spaces that are visually appealing and extremely functional.

Fundamental Principles of Minimalist Design

The essence of minimalist architecture lies in a set of fundamental principles that shape its design philosophy. These principles emphasize clarity, functionality, and effective space utilization, creating environments that evoke tranquility and order.

  • Simplicity: Prioritizing essential forms devoid of ornamentation, akin to a canvas featuring select brush strokes for impactful visuals.
  • Functionality: Ensuring every architectural element serves a purpose. Like well-crafted tools designed for specific tasks, architectural features focus on usability and efficiency.
  • Open Spaces: Highlighting spaciousness through strategic layouts and visual connections, fostering a sense of freedom in thoughtfully designed rooms.
  • Natural Materials: Utilizing materials such as wood, stone, and glass that connect the building to its natural environment, reflecting the simplicity and beauty inherent in nature.
  • Light and Shadow: Leveraging the interplay of light and shadow as key design elements to enhance depth and intrigue without cluttering the space.

Practical Applications of Minimalist Design

Minimalist design is prevalent in many worldwide architectural landmarks, encompassing residential structures to commercial buildings. Its principles enable architects to design environments that promote tranquility, organization, and practical functionality. Key applications include residential developments, office design, and urban planning projects.

  • Residential Homes: Open floor plans create fluid transitions between spaces, enhancing the livability and aesthetic charm of homes.
  • Commercial Spaces: Applying minimalist design in workplaces helps increase productivity by reducing distractions and fostering an uncluttered environment.
  • Urban Planning: Parks and public areas designed with minimalist principles offer moments of peace within bustling urban environments, providing tranquility for city inhabitants.

Conclusion

In conclusion, the fundamental principles of minimalist design in contemporary architecture emphasize simplicity, functionality, and a seamless connection to nature. By focusing on these characteristics, architects create spaces that not only attract attention but also elevate the experience of their occupants.

Expert Quote

Tadao Ando, Renowned Architect

The design of space is a prerequisite for the creation of beauty. To create beauty, we need to discard the unnecessary to find what is essential.

The Floating World: The Architecture of Tadao Ando, 2008
